We are looking for a valuable new Nursery Lead to join our EYFS team: a fantastic opportunity for someone who is genuinely motivated by the desire to make a positive difference to pupils' lives.

Qualifications

  • Passionate and committed individual who is an enthusiastic, calm person who will be able to support pupils' learning and development in collaboration with other teachers and support staff.
  • Willingness to learn, coupled with good interpersonal skills and a desire to make a difference in the lives of children.
  • EYFS childcare qualifications of level 3 or above.

Responsibilities

  • Lead a team of EYFS practitioners, plan activities, liaise with parents regarding new intakes, provide general class support and be a named key worker within our Nursery setting (2-4 years).
  • Be committed to our school's ethos of positivity.
  • Enjoy working hard in a supportive network of professionals.
  • Be able to challenge and motivate all children to succeed.
  • Have a love of learning and be committed to their own development.
  • Be an adaptable team player with a good sense of humour.
  • Have a good understanding of teaching systematics phonics.
  • Hold a paediatric first aid certificate.

Information about the School: We are a two-form entry primary school and nursery set in extensive grounds on the periphery of Ockendon Village. Our school is only a 3 minute walk from South Ockendon station, which is on the C2C Fenchurch to Shoeburyness line and within easy reach (5 minutes) of the A13 and A127 into London/Southend and the Dartford Bridge. How to prepare for a job interview at Shorefields

✨Know Your EYFS Inside Out

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of the Early Years Foundation Stage (EYFS) framework. Be ready to discuss how you can implement it in your nursery setting and share examples of activities you've planned that align with EYFS goals.

✨Show Your Passion for Child Development

During the interview, express your genuine enthusiasm for making a positive impact on children's lives. Share personal anecdotes or experiences that highlight your commitment to supporting pupils' learning and development.

✨Demonstrate Team Leadership Skills

As a Nursery Lead, you'll be leading a team. Prepare to discuss your leadership style and how you foster collaboration among staff. Think of specific instances where you've successfully motivated a team or resolved conflicts.

✨Prepare Questions for the Interviewer

Have a few thoughtful questions ready for Samantha Oxley or the interview panel. This shows your interest in the role and the school. You might ask about their approach to professional development or how they support new staff in adapting to the school's ethos.
